Psicoactivo Podcast is a weekly show that explores UAP phenomena, consciousness, shamanism, and disclosure from perspectives often marginalized in mainstream media. It hosts guests ranging from researchers, whistleblowers, writers, and experiencers to dissidents inside official circles. It matters because it bridges multiple disciplines, scientific, spiritual, and journalistic, to engage UAP issues in a way that pushes beyond binary skepticism versus sensationalism. Episodes often blend investigative journalism with philosophical inquiry, offering listeners both data and mystery.
The podcast’s episode catalogue is rich and varied. It features interviews with recognized figures like Rob Jones discussing the financial trails of the UFO Legacy Program, Andy McGrillen on the Atlas of Unidentified Flying Objects, and Rizwan Virk on the intersection of UFOs, consciousness, and artificial intelligence. Past shows delve into historical cases, such as the 1977 California UAP flap, and explore themes like trauma, mental health, and “high strangeness.” Psicoactivo also examines more speculative claims, including Nazca tridactyl mummies, alleged black-triangle encounters, or supposed programs involving secret power sources, while often noting gaps in evidence and provenance. The host frequently critiques both claims and counterclaims, holding strong to critical independence.
One of the podcast’s distinguishing traits is how it treats disclosure not simply as the release of documents but as a transformation in public understanding. Psicoactivo frames whistleblower testimonies and alleged leaks within broader ethical, cultural, and spiritual contexts, asking how knowledge is revealed, who it benefits, and why the shape of the unknown matters. For example, episodes investigating congressional hearings, alleged suppression of high-resolution UAP videos, or the role of religious narratives in interpreting anomalous phenomena illustrate that the podcast sees disclosure as multidimensional.
